AARON RAY - ART at THE 400

By: Todd Berger

Aaron Ray, Denver illustrator, designer, and JE Contributor will be showing at The 400 this Thursday, the 21st. The crew at The 400 sent us over a sneak peak of what’s in store and Aaron’s new work is lookin’ good. In typical 400 fashion Mr. Ray seems to have handled a pretty massive title mural. We can’t wait to see what he’s been up to. The show entitled, pretender, opens at 7 and ends when everyone rolls out.  Stop by The 400 to check out Aaron’s new work and scope the latest on the sneaker front.

AARON RAY at THE 400

By: Todd Berger

Come February 21st, Aaron Ray, Denver based designer and illustrator and JoyEngine contributor we’ll be having a solo show at the 400. Aaron’s show entitled, pretender will consist of 15 new works; various drawings of people on both wood and paper. You can look forward to 5 large works and 10 smaller. Mr Ray has put together a super fresh lil’ promo video in preparation for the show. Have a look!

NOTE: The 400 has moved their openings to the third thursday of the month, so mark you calendars.

    A City Renewal Project.  Opens November 7, 2008 in Toronto, Canada.  This is a collaborative street art installation between Specter and Fauxreel, recreating a decayed neighborhood inside a 4000 sq/ft warehouse space. More info at City Renewal Project

    Dan Funderburgh has teamed up with the masterminds at Animal New York and Geekhouse Bikes to create artwork for a Barack track bike. The frame is hand built and the patterns are sublimated onto the frame. The bike is for up on auction on ebay, with all proceeds going to the Obama campaign. Bid on it now. More photos here.
